Just out of curiosity, if the horsemen wouldnt mind, what mods have you guys done to your longshots?

Pretty much exactly what was discussed in Carrtoon's thread on the subject. Removed the air-restrictors and added a Big Bad Bow spring. For my part, I didn't even remove the air restrictors-- just added a BBB spring. That seemed to tone down the weapon's power enough to prevent the spinouts everyone's been complaining about.
